Hinges and jack stands should be oiled or greased. Make a point to wash and clean your trailer’s interior and exterior, and wax all painted areas before storing. Remove any floor mats before cleaning. If the floor is aluminum, inspect it thoroughly for corrosion – alkaline in urine and manure is very harmful to aluminum floors. If the aluminum floor has a covering that is not removable such as Rhino Lining, check the underneath for signs of corrosion. If it has a wood floor, check for soft spots or rotting. When the time comes to store your trailer for the off-season, take stock. It’s a good time to evaluate worn and broken items that need replacing, such as latches, tire covers, running lights, turn signals, etc. Try and get those repairs, parts, and possible upgrades done before show season comes in order to beat the rush.
